In A.D. 781 King Charles of the Franks is crossing the Alps with his family and tells his son, Carl, that one day he will be King. But what about Pepin, the first born? Was he to be dispossessed? THis many-faceted story will stir the minds and imaginations of young people.

By putting over 3,000 years of faces on the search for the elemental principles -- from the Greek philosopher Anaximander, who held that all the material world was made of four "elements", Earth, Air, Fire, and Water; to teams of modern scientists who race to create new elements -- Benjamin Wiker has moved chemistry off the shelf of dry-and-dusty arcania and given the reader a gum-shoe tale filled with odd and interesting characters.
